# #!/usr/bin/env python3
# """Test script for _noisy_email_address implementation."""
# from object_mother_pattern.mothers.internet import EmailAddressMother
# def test_noisy_email_address():
# """Test the _noisy_email_address method with various inputs."""
# # Test with no noise
# result = EmailAddressMother._noisy_email_address(
# local_part="testuser",
# include_special_chars=False,
# include_numbers=False
# )
# print(f"No noise: {result}")
# assert result == "testuser", "Should return unchanged when no noise requested"
# # Test with numbers only
# for i in range(5):
# result = EmailAddressMother._noisy_email_address(
# local_part="testuser",
# include_special_chars=False,
# include_numbers=True
# )
# print(f"Numbers only (attempt {i+1}): {result}")
# # Check that numbers were added
# has_numbers = any(c.isdigit() for c in result)
# assert has_numbers, "Should contain at least one number"
# assert "testuser" in result or any(c in result for c in "testuser"), "Should contain original characters"
# # Test with special chars only
# for i in range(5):
# result = EmailAddressMother._noisy_email_address(
# local_part="testuser",
# include_special_chars=True,
# include_numbers=False
# )
# print(f"Special chars only (attempt {i+1}): {result}")
# # Check for special characters
# special_chars = ['.', '_', '-', '+']
# has_special = any(c in result for c in special_chars)
# assert has_special or result == "testuser", "Should contain special char or be unchanged"
# # Check RFC compliance
# assert not result.startswith('.'), "Should not start with dot"
# assert not result.endswith('.'), "Should not end with dot"
# assert '..' not in result, "Should not have consecutive dots"
# # Test with both numbers and special chars
# for i in range(5):
# result = EmailAddressMother._noisy_email_address(
# local_part="testuser",
# include_special_chars=True,
# include_numbers=True
# )
# print(f"Both noise types (attempt {i+1}): {result}")
# # Verify it's not empty
# assert result, "Result should not be empty"
# # Check RFC compliance
# assert not result.startswith('.'), "Should not start with dot"
# assert not result.endswith('.'), "Should not end with dot"
# assert '..' not in result, "Should not have consecutive dots"
# # Test with short input
# result = EmailAddressMother._noisy_email_address(
# local_part="a",
# include_special_chars=True,
# include_numbers=True
# )
# print(f"Short input with noise: {result}")
# assert result, "Should handle short input"
# # Test with empty string edge case
# result = EmailAddressMother._noisy_email_address(
# local_part="",
# include_special_chars=True,
# include_numbers=True
# )
# print(f"Empty input: {result}")
# assert result == "", "Should handle empty input gracefully"
# print("\nAll tests passed!")
# if __name__ == "__main__":
# test_noisy_email_address()
